ColCORONA: Colchicine Reduces Complications in Outpatient COVID-19 – Medscape
The primary endpoint was not significant in the overall population, but in those with PCR-confirmed COVID, treatment reduced hospitalization, need for ventilation,…

Editor’s note: Find the latest COVID-19 news and guidance in Medscape’s Coronavirus Resource Center.
The oral, anti-inflammatory drug colchicine can prevent complications and hospitalizations in nonhospitalized patients newly diagnosed with COVID-19, according to a press release from the ColCORONA trial investigators.
After 1 month of therapy, there was a 21% risk reduction in the primary composite endpoint of death or hospitalizations that missed statistical significance, compared with placebo…
